  1. The 2012 FIG World Cup circuit in Rhythmic Gymnastics includes one category A event (Sofia) and six category B events. Apart from Corbeil-Essonnes (individuals only), all events include both, individual and group competitions, with all-around competitions serving as qualifications for the finals by apparatus. Eleni Kelaiditi ( Greek: Ελένη Κελαϊδίτη; born April 1, 2000, in Cholargos, Greece) is a Greek individual rhythmic gymnast. She is a two-time Greek Junior National all-around champion.

  3. Margarita "Rita" Mamun (born November 1, 1995 in Moscow, Russia) is a retired Russian rhythmic gymnast. She won a gold medal in the individual all-around competition at the 2016 Rio Olympics.   4. Alexandra Ana Maria Agiurgiuculese (born 15 January 2001) is a Romanian - Italian individual rhythmic gymnast who represents Italy. She is a World Championships silver and bronze medalist, and she competed at the 2020 Summer Olympics. Agiurgiuculese was the first Italian gymnast to win the Longines Prize for Elegance.

  6. The 2000 FIG Rhythmic Gymnastics World Cup Final was the fourth edition of the Rhythmic Gymnastics World Cup Final, held in December 2000 in Glasgow, United Kingdom, at the Braehead Arena. [1] [2] The competition was officially organized by the International Gymnastics Federation under a different format compared to the previous editions.
